Fixed prices
| Job | From | Typical time | What sets the price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Single item collection | £45 | 20–40 min | One sofa, mattress or fridge carried out and weighed in at a licensed transfer station. |
| Quarter-load (approx. 3 cubic yards) | £120 | 45–75 min | Priced on volume in the van plus tip weight, not on how long the crew is on site. |
| Half-load (approx. 6 cubic yards) | £200 | 1–2 hrs | A typical garage or one-bedroom flat clear-out including loose bagged waste. |
| Full Luton load (approx. 12 cubic yards) | £380 | 2–4 hrs | Full van, two crew, transfer-station charge and the waste transfer note included. |
| Fridge, freezer or air-con unit | £65 | 20–30 min | Gas-containing appliances go to a WEEE-permitted site, which charges per unit. |
| Garden or builders' waste, per cubic yard | £70 | By volume | Soil, rubble and hardcore are heavy: those loads are capped by weight, not space. |

Domestic prices are the total you pay. Landlord and commercial invoices are quoted plus VAT at 20%. Where a permit, bay suspension, ULEZ or Congestion Charge applies it is itemised in the written quote before the crew is booked, never added afterwards.
